Why this coin matters

The 1899 Morgan Dollar was struck at the Philadelphia Mint with a recorded mintage of 330,000 coins — the 6th-lowest of the 96 circulation-strike issues in the morgan dollar series, and 2% of the 15,182,000 morgan dollars the Mint produced across all facilities in 1899.

Low mintage but survival is better than the figure suggests.

Mintage: the 1899 morgan dollar, mint by mint

IssueMintMintage
1899 Morgan DollarPhiladelphia330,000
1899-O Morgan DollarNew Orleans12,290,000
1899-S Morgan DollarSan Francisco2,562,000
